Find the best earbuds for calls in 2026
Call clarity depends on:
- Microphone Quality - Multiple mics with AI noise reduction
- Wind Noise Handling - Clear voice outdoors
- Multipoint - Switch between phone and laptop seamlessly
- Comfortable All-Day Wear - Light enough for continuous use
